Retired National Football League tight end Marco Antonio Battaglia was born on Jan. 25, 1973, and raised in Howard Beach, Queens. After capping a stellar football career at Rutgers University as a consensus first-team All-American in 1995, Battaglia played for five pro teams in eight seasons. Ray “Boom Boom” Mancini will appear at the Watertown Area Boxing Club’s 10th annual Carmen Basilio Quest for Champions in September. Mancini will appear at a “Dinner with a Champion,” event at the Italian-American Club on Friday, Sept. 7 before serving as the Guest of Honor for the WABC’s annual flagship boxing show the following night.
